Transaction 7ef08509a1f3a6efae9ee301bac4600d3da4862e7ef70d8f5a1b8b9330654fa2

1 Input
2 Outputs
  • 7ef08509a1f3a6efae9ee301bac4600d3da4862e7ef70d8f5a1b8b9330654fa2:0
  • value  4247868
    address  38fc39WL3MedHpzFSr1sXYnyw4so8BBLDn
  • 7ef08509a1f3a6efae9ee301bac4600d3da4862e7ef70d8f5a1b8b9330654fa2:1
  • value  25960698
    address  19B6FCUrXJwoM1xexV19EMcF9MihTnLMcf